The establishment of the first Vitthal-Rukmini Temple in the UK is a significant cultural, spiritual, and community-driven initiative. The first-ever Vitthal-Rukmini Temple in the UK will be a landmark in the spiritual and cultural landscape of Europe. This historic initiative, supported by devotees worldwide, brings the sacred traditions of Pandharpur to London, creating a lasting legacy for future generations. The establishment of this temple is not only a significant cultural and spiritual endeavour but also a unifying force for the Indian diaspora in the UK and Europe.
Carrying the sacred paduka (footwear of Lord Vitthal) across 22 countries and 17,500 km, this journey is a testament to devotion, unity, and faith, engaging devotees in an unparalleled spiritual movement. The temple will serve as a sacred space for worship, a cultural hub, and a beacon of Indian heritage, fostering a deeper connection with spirituality for generations to come.
